Arnold wants a pet. His mother has reasons why each one will not work. A dog, a cat, and even far more unusual creatures pass through Arnold’s hopeful imagination, but every idea meets a firm no. The fun comes from how large and wild Arnold’s pet wishes become, and from the quieter feeling underneath them: he is really looking for someone to share his days with. Steven Kellogg’s humorous picture book turns a child’s longing for a pet into a warm story about companionship. With playful exaggeration and a gentle emotional center, it is a good fit for readers who like animal stories, funny family conversations, and imaginative problem solving.
